Population Overview

Berkeley County is located in South Carolina with a total population of 238,723. It is the 8th most populous county out of 46 in South Carolina.

Age Demographics

The median age in Berkeley County is 36.7 years. This is 8% lower than the state median of 40.1 years.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Berkeley County is $82,327. This is 23% higher than the state median of $66,818.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 5% higher. The poverty rate stands at 10.3%. This is 27% lower than the state poverty rate of 14.2%. The unemployment rate is 3.6%. This is 26% lower than the state rate of 5.0%. The median home value is $280,300. Housing costs are 18% higher than the state median of $236,700. The home-value-to-income ratio is 3.4x. 74.1%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 4% higher than the state average of 71.4%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Berkeley County is White (non-Hispanic), making up 60.7% of the population. Black or African American residents account for 22.9%.

Education

29.9%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 5% lower than the state rate of 31.5%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 90.6%.
